We recently received a new shipment of 2011 MacBook Pros and I'm testing our new 10.7.4 image on the first five of them. The imaging worked fine, however I'm experiencing some strange behavior on the JAMF side of things.

I've assigned these computers to our "Teachers" department and they show up in the inventory list if I search for that department. They also show up in the inventory when I search for Operating System Version "like" 10.7. They do not show up if I do a search for both of those conditions. This is a hassle for me because I'm trying to set up a smart group for these new computers to distinguish them from our 10.6 computers.

Another weird behavior is not one of these 5 new computers shows up in Casper Remote.

As far as troubleshooting, I've rebooted our JSS and also ran a "Repair Databases" but no luck yet.

Any ideas?

I figured out part of the issue. The computers were getting imaged and inventoried, but not managed. Is there a way to automatically have the computers be managed once imaging is complete? I didn't see a place in PreStage to set this.

If you edit the configuration of the image in Casper admin, there is a management tab. Check that you have these options set.
